Servlet 点击计数器
引言
随着互联网的快速发展,网站和应用程序的用户交互变得越来越频繁。为了更好地了解用户行为,许多网站和应用程序都引入了点击计数器。Servlet 点击计数器是一种常见的实现方式,它可以帮助开发者实时了解用户对特定内容的点击情况。本文将详细介绍 Servlet 点击计数器的原理、实现方法以及在实际应用中的注意事项。
Servlet 点击计数器原理
Servlet 点击计数器通过记录用户对特定页面的点击次数来实现。其基本原理如下:
- 存储点击次数:在服务器端,通常使用数据库或文件系统来存储点击次数。当用户点击页面时,系统会读取存储的点击次数,并在点击后更新该次数。
- 读取点击次数:当用户访问页面时,服务器会从存储中读取点击次数,并将其显示在页面上。
- 更新点击次数:每次用户点击页面时,服务器都会更新存储的点击次数。
Servlet 点击计数器实现方法
以下是使用 Servlet 实现点击计数器的基本步骤:
1. 创建数据库表
首先,需要创建一个数据库表来存储点击次数。以下是一个简单的 SQL 语句,用于创建名为click_count的表:
CREATE TABLE click_count ( id INT PRIMARY KEY AUTO_INCREMENT, count INT DEFAULT 0 );2. 创建 Servlet
接下来,创建一个 Servlet 来处理点击计数逻辑。以下是一个简单的 Servlet 示例:
import javax.servlet.*; import javax.servlet.http.*; import java.io.IOE